+#include "parser.h"
+#include "ac3_parser.h"
+#include "aac_ac3_parser.h"
+#include "get_bits.h"
+
+
+#define AC3_HEADER_SIZE 7
+
+
+static const uint8_t eac3_blocks[4] = {
+ 1, 2, 3, 6
+};
+
+
+int ff_ac3_parse_header(GetBitContext *gbc, AC3HeaderInfo *hdr)
+{
+ int frame_size_code;
+
+ memset(hdr, 0, sizeof(*hdr));
+
+ hdr->sync_word = get_bits(gbc, 16);
+ if(hdr->sync_word != 0x0B77)
+ return AAC_AC3_PARSE_ERROR_SYNC;
+
+ /* read ahead to bsid to distinguish between AC-3 and E-AC-3 */
+ hdr->bitstream_id = show_bits_long(gbc, 29) & 0x1F;
+ if(hdr->bitstream_id > 16)
+ return AAC_AC3_PARSE_ERROR_BSID;
+
+ hdr->num_blocks = 6;
+
+ /* set default mix levels */
+ hdr->center_mix_level = 1; // -4.5dB
+ hdr->surround_mix_level = 1; // -6.0dB
+
+ if(hdr->bitstream_id <= 10) {
+ /* Normal AC-3 */
+ hdr->crc1 = get_bits(gbc, 16);
+ hdr->sr_code = get_bits(gbc, 2);
+ if(hdr->sr_code == 3)
+ return AAC_AC3_PARSE_ERROR_SAMPLE_RATE;
+
+ frame_size_code = get_bits(gbc, 6);
+ if(frame_size_code > 37)
+ return AAC_AC3_PARSE_ERROR_FRAME_SIZE;
+
+ skip_bits(gbc, 5); // skip bsid, already got it
+
+ skip_bits(gbc, 3); // skip bitstream mode
+ hdr->channel_mode = get_bits(gbc, 3);
+
+ if(hdr->channel_mode == AC3_CHMODE_STEREO) {
+ skip_bits(gbc, 2); // skip dsurmod
+ } else {
+ if((hdr->channel_mode & 1) && hdr->channel_mode != AC3_CHMODE_MONO)
+ hdr->center_mix_level = get_bits(gbc, 2);
+ if(hdr->channel_mode & 4)
+ hdr->surround_mix_level = get_bits(gbc, 2);
+ }
+ hdr->lfe_on = get_bits1(gbc);
+
+ hdr->sr_shift = FFMAX(hdr->bitstream_id, 8) - 8;
+ hdr->sample_rate = ff_ac3_sample_rate_tab[hdr->sr_code] >> hdr->sr_shift;
+ hdr->bit_rate = (ff_ac3_bitrate_tab[frame_size_code>>1] * 1000) >> hdr->sr_shift;
+ hdr->channels = ff_ac3_channels_tab[hdr->channel_mode] + hdr->lfe_on;
+ hdr->frame_size = ff_ac3_frame_size_tab[frame_size_code][hdr->sr_code] * 2;
+ hdr->frame_type = EAC3_FRAME_TYPE_AC3_CONVERT; //EAC3_FRAME_TYPE_INDEPENDENT;
+ hdr->substreamid = 0;
+ } else {
+ /* Enhanced AC-3 */
+ hdr->crc1 = 0;
+ hdr->frame_type = get_bits(gbc, 2);
+ if(hdr->frame_type == EAC3_FRAME_TYPE_RESERVED)
+ return AAC_AC3_PARSE_ERROR_FRAME_TYPE;
+
+ hdr->substreamid = get_bits(gbc, 3);
+
+ hdr->frame_size = (get_bits(gbc, 11) + 1) << 1;
+ if(hdr->frame_size < AC3_HEADER_SIZE)
+ return AAC_AC3_PARSE_ERROR_FRAME_SIZE;
+
+ hdr->sr_code = get_bits(gbc, 2);
+ if (hdr->sr_code == 3) {
+ int sr_code2 = get_bits(gbc, 2);
+ if(sr_code2 == 3)
+ return AAC_AC3_PARSE_ERROR_SAMPLE_RATE;
+ hdr->sample_rate = ff_ac3_sample_rate_tab[sr_code2] / 2;
+ hdr->sr_shift = 1;
+ } else {
+ hdr->num_blocks = eac3_blocks[get_bits(gbc, 2)];
+ hdr->sample_rate = ff_ac3_sample_rate_tab[hdr->sr_code];
+ hdr->sr_shift = 0;
+ }
+
+ hdr->channel_mode = get_bits(gbc, 3);
+ hdr->lfe_on = get_bits1(gbc);
+
+ hdr->bit_rate = (uint32_t)(8.0 * hdr->frame_size * hdr->sample_rate /
+ (hdr->num_blocks * 256.0));
+ hdr->channels = ff_ac3_channels_tab[hdr->channel_mode] + hdr->lfe_on;
+ }
+ hdr->channel_layout = ff_ac3_channel_layout_tab[hdr->channel_mode];
+ if (hdr->lfe_on)
+ hdr->channel_layout |= CH_LOW_FREQUENCY;
+
+ return 0;
+}

+int ff_ac3_parse_header_full(GetBitContext *gbc, AC3HeaderInfo *hdr){
+ int ret, i;
+ ret = ff_ac3_parse_header(gbc, hdr);
+ if(!ret){
+ if(hdr->bitstream_id>10){
+ /* Enhanced AC-3 */
+ skip_bits(gbc, 5); // skip bitstream id
+
+ /* skip dialog normalization and compression gain */
+ for (i = 0; i < (hdr->channel_mode ? 1 : 2); i++) {
+ skip_bits(gbc, 5); // skip dialog normalization
+ if (get_bits1(gbc)) {
+ skip_bits(gbc, 8); //skip Compression gain word
+ }
+ }
+ /* dependent stream channel map */
+ if (hdr->frame_type == EAC3_FRAME_TYPE_DEPENDENT && get_bits1(gbc)) {
+ hdr->channel_map = get_bits(gbc, 16); //custom channel map
+ return 0;
+ }
+ }
+ //default channel map based on acmod and lfeon
+ hdr->channel_map = ff_eac3_default_chmap[hdr->channel_mode];
+ if(hdr->lfe_on)
+ hdr->channel_map |= AC3_CHMAP_LFE;
+ }
+ return ret;
+}
+
+static int ac3_sync(uint64_t state, AACAC3ParseContext *hdr_info,
+ int *need_next_header, int *new_frame_start)
+{
+ int err;
+ union {
+ uint64_t u64;
+ uint8_t u8[8];
+ } tmp = { be2me_64(state) };
+ AC3HeaderInfo hdr;
+ GetBitContext gbc;
+
+ init_get_bits(&gbc, tmp.u8+8-AC3_HEADER_SIZE, 54);
+ err = ff_ac3_parse_header(&gbc, &hdr);
+
+ if(err < 0)
+ return 0;
+
+ hdr_info->sample_rate = hdr.sample_rate;
+ hdr_info->bit_rate = hdr.bit_rate;
+ hdr_info->channels = hdr.channels;
+ hdr_info->channel_layout = hdr.channel_layout;
+ hdr_info->samples = hdr.num_blocks * 256;
+ if(hdr.bitstream_id>10)
+ hdr_info->codec_id = CODEC_ID_EAC3;
+ else
+ hdr_info->codec_id = CODEC_ID_AC3;
+
+ *need_next_header = (hdr.frame_type != EAC3_FRAME_TYPE_AC3_CONVERT);
+ *new_frame_start = (hdr.frame_type != EAC3_FRAME_TYPE_DEPENDENT);
+ return hdr.frame_size;
+}
+
+static av_cold int ac3_parse_init(AVCodecParserContext *s1)
+{
+ AACAC3ParseContext *s = s1->priv_data;
+ s->header_size = AC3_HEADER_SIZE;
+ s->sync = ac3_sync;
+ return 0;
+}
+
+
+AVCodecParser ac3_parser = {
+ { CODEC_ID_AC3, CODEC_ID_EAC3 },
+ sizeof(AACAC3ParseContext),
+ ac3_parse_init,
+ ff_aac_ac3_parse,
+ ff_parse_close,
+};
